The Vikings held a strategic foothold in the Orkney Islands for centuries, and their Norse heritage is still evident throughout the archipelago. Here, we begin our exploration in true expedition style, discovering some of Orkney's lesser-known islands on archaeology walks, birding hikes, and Zodiac or kayak excursions, conditions permitting. The following day, we arrive in Kirkwall, from which we explore fascinating Stone Age sites, including the megaliths of the Ring of Brodgar and the 5,000-year-old stone-slab village of Skara Brae. We also have the opportunity to visit the medieval St. Magnus Cathedral in Kirkwall, which was founded in 1137 by the Viking Earl Rognvald. ... Read More

Arrive at Unst, the northernmost island of the Shetlands, which harbors sheltered inlets, golden beaches, and a large nature reserve. Take to the trails onshore to skirt towering cliffs and heather-covered hills. Weather permitting, paddle the scenic coastline by kayak, or cruise in a Zodiac to the farthest northern lighthouse in the UK. Or, visit the Unst Heritage Centre, which features local artifacts including handspun knit and lace, fishing tools, and wooden boats. At sunset, cruise below the towering cliffs of Noss, a nature reserve that harbors thousands of seabirds including puffins, guillemots, and kittiwakes. Arrive in Lerwick in the late evening. ... In the bustling seaport of Lerwick, choose from several options. Explore the town, strolling amid 18th-century sandstone warehouses; delve into local culture and history at the Shetland Museum and Archives; or embark on a bird-watching or a geology-focused excursion. Alternatively, discover the prehistoric settlement of Jarlshof-which reveals 4,000 years of near-continuous settlement-and examine Bronze Age ruins and Viking longhouses. Norway's glacier-carved western coast boasts some of the most dramatic landscapes in the world. Launch kayaks and Zodiacs to explore the sublime Hardangerfjord, the second-longest fjord in the country and the fourth-longest in the world. Cruise beneath staggering cliffs and rushing waterfalls and venture ashore to hike against a backdrop of snow-dusted mountains, emerald valleys, and fruit orchards. ... Read More
